Linux常用基础命令

常用基础命令:
su:切换到管理员
su - chen:切换到此用户
clear:清屏(Ctrl+l)也是清屏
pwd:显示当前目录
cd:切换到工作目录 相对路径:. 当前目录 .. 切换到上一级目录 ~ 切换到家目录 -返回上一次目录
mkdir:创建一个文件夹
touch:创建一个文件
rm -rf:强制删除文件 -r:删除目录
uname -r:查看内核版本
ifup ens33:激活此网卡
ifdown ens33:断开此网卡
ifconfig:查看版本状态
cat:查看本文文件内容
netstat -anpt | grep 80:查看此端口是否开启
chmod 777 /abc :赋予跟下abc满权限
mkdir -p :创建多级目录
cp 复制 -r 是强制复制
which:查找命令所在位置
find:查找文件目录:find查找范围 查找条件

vim (vi):都是编辑器
vim 后面跟文件:是进入到此文件
vim /etc/sysconfig/network-scripts/ifcfg-ens33:ip地址的路径
BOOTROTO=dhcp:自动获取地址
ONBOOT=yes:是否开机自启
DEVICCE=eth33:网卡名字
IPADDR=192.168.10.1:ip地址
NETMASK=255.255.255.0:掩码
GATEWAY=192.168.10.1:网关
dd:是删除一行 10dd:是删除10行 yy:是复制一行 10yy:复制10行 p:粘贴
i:进入编辑模式 :q!强制退出 :wq 保存并退出
systemctl network restart:重新启动网络
systemctl iptables stop:关闭防火墙
systemctl iptables start:开启防火墙
systemctl status network.service:查看网络状态
systemctl reload network.service:重新加载配置文件

tar
-c:建立压缩档案
-x:解压
-t:查看内容
-r:向压缩归档文件末尾追加文件
-u:更新原压缩包中的文件
这五个是独立的命令,压缩解压都要用到其中一个,可以和别的命令连用但只能用其中一个。下面的参数是根据需要在压缩或解压档案时可选的

-z:有gzip属性的
-j:有bz2属性的
-Z:有compress属性的
-v:显示所有过程
-O:将文件解开到标准输出

下面的参数-f是必须的
-f:使用档案名字,切记,这个参数是最后一个参数,后面只能接档案名
tar -cf all.tar *.jpg
这条命令是将所有的.jpg的文件达成一个名为all.jpg的包。-c是表是产生新的包,-f指定包的文件名
tar -rf all.tar*.gif
这条命令是将所有.gif的文件增加到all.tar的包里面去,-r是表示增加文件的意思
tar -uf all.tar logo.gif
这条命令是更新原来tar包all.tar中logo.gif文件,-u是表示更新文件的意思
tar -tf all.tar
这条命令是列出all.tar包中所有文件,-t是列出文件的意思
tar -xf all.tar
这条命令是解出all.tar包中所有文件,-t是解开的意思

解压
tar -xvf file.tar //解压tar包
tar -xzvf file.tar.gz //tar.gz
tar -xjvf file.tar.bz2 //解压tar.bz2

压缩
tar -cvf jpg.tar *.jpg //将目录里所有jpg文件打包成tar.jpg

tar -czf jpg.tar.gz *.jpg //将目录里所有jpg文件打包成jpg.tar后,并且将其用gzip压缩,生成一个gzip压缩过的包,命名为jpg.tar.gz

tar -cjf jpg.tar.bz2 *.jpg //将目录里所有jpg文件打包成jpg.tar后,并且将其用bzip2压缩,生成一个bzip2压缩过的包,命名为jpg.tar.bz2

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值